An information-packed guide to optimising your brain health today and for the future.
Become body literate with Brain - An Owner's Guide, the next book in The Body Literacy Library, an enlightening series that will democratise health for a new generation of readers.
Brain - An Owner's Guide is an informative and practical guide to all aspects of brain health, from maximising your mental wellbeing today to protecting your brain against future serious health issues. Leading neuroscientist Eli Ricker explains how the brain works, how you can look after and protect your brain, and explains what you can do to improve your memory and concentration at any age.
Ricker also examines what constitutes mental "wellbeing", and the science behind a positive mindset, resilience, concentration, and memory, as well as low mood, depression, and brain fog. Dementia and other brain disorders are a huge concern for many, and Ricker explores how these occur, the latest medical research, and what you can do to protect your brain for life.
From the importance of sleep and stress management to why dementia is a feminist issue, this hard-working book applies science to the everyday, with simple illustrations, checklists, FAQs, and myth busters, all supported by the latest medical research. Brain - An Owner's Guide can help you to better understand your mind and aims to enhance your long-term quality of life.

About the Author
Elizabeth Ricker is a leading neuroscientist with degrees in Brain and Cognitive Sciences from MIT and Mind, Brain, and Education from Harvard. Eli Ricker is the author of Smarter Tomorrow- How 15 minutes of Neurohacking a day can help you work better, think faster and get more done (Little Brown Spark/Hachette, 2021), winner of a 2022 International Nautilus Book Award. Eli Ricker has been featured in The Wall Street Journal, Harvard Magazine, The Hindu, Fast company, The Stylist and more.
